Bob Gutteridge Estate Agents are delighted to bring to the market this beautifully presented and recently updated and modernised fore courted terraced home situated in this desirable Madeley Heath location. This home offers the modern day comforts of Upvc double glazing along with gas central heating and in brief the accommodation comprises of dining room, lounge, modern fitted kitchen and to the first floor are two bedrooms along with a first floor shower room. Externally the property offers an enclosed rear yard which backs onto a playing field. The location is perfect for access to A525 which provides access to both Newcastle and Crewe as well as being near to local shops, schools and amenities. Viewing Is Highly Recommended !

Dining Room - 3.35m x 3.28m (11'0" x 10'9") - With Upvc double glazed window to front, composite double glazed frosted front access door with skylight above, pendant light fitting, panelled radiator, oak effect laminate flooring, power points and door to;

Lounge - 4.06m x 3.28m (13'4" x 10'9") - With Upvc double glazed window to rear, pendant light fitting, coving to ceiling, part exposed feature chimney with oak mantle shelf and log effect electric fire, TV aerial connection, power points, door to under stairs store, stairs to first floor landing and door to;

Fitted Kitchen - 7.39m x 1.91m (24'3" x 6'3") - With two Upvc double glazed windows to side, Upvc double glazed French doors to rear, two light fittings, a range of base and wall mounted storage cupboards providing ample domestic cupboard and drawer space, butchers block work surfaces with integrated resin sink unit with mixer tap above, built in four ring gas hob unit, built in oven, plumbing for automatic washing machine, space for condenser dryer, space for fridge/freezer, ceramic splashback tiling, ceramic tiled flooring, power points and a built in cupboard housing the central heating boiler providing the domestic hot water and central heating systems.

First Floor Landing - With pendant light fitting and doors to rooms including;

Bedroom One - 3.35m x 3.28m (11'0" x 10'9") - With Upvc double glazed window to front, pendant light fitting, panelled radiator and power points.

Bedroom Two - 4.04m x 2.36m (13'3" x 7'9") - With Upvc double glazed window to rear, pendant light fitting, panelled radiator and power points.

First Floor Shower Room - 2.64m x 1.93m (8'8" x 6'4") - With Upvc double glazed frosted window to rear, a white suite comprising of low level WC, vanity sink unit with mixer tap above, walk in double shower enclosed, ceramic wall tiling, herringbone style flooring and door to built in airing cupboard.

    The company was first founded by husband and wife partnership Bob and Katrina Gutteridge at their present office at Porthill, Newcastle, Staffs in April 1989. The firm became a limited company in June 2004 and over this long period has become well established as one of the leaders in residential estate agency and property lettings and management in the North Staffordshire area and has become part of the local community in the Porthill area and due to its success now offers a vast range of property for sale and to let and a full range of estate agency services throughout the entire Potteries and Newcastle regions. The firm has two major disciplines, firstly the sale of new and second hand properties and this department is headed up by Stephen Gutteridge and also provides support and advice to major national house builders in respect of part exchange and assisted sale properties, and further provides valuation and investment advice to buy to let landlords. Stephen Gutteridge commenced his estate agency career in 2001 and qualified by examination in 2007 to become a member of the National Association of Estate Agents, and given his qualifications, clients of the company can be assured that the firm conforms to the highest standards of professional competence in its estate agency activities. The companies other main area of activity is in residential property management, this department is directed by Katrina Gutteridge and looks after a vast number of both private landlords rented properties and corporate clients portfolios and following Katrina’s long experience in the residential market locally she has become regarded as a specialist in this sector and her advice and assistance is widely sought by both local and national landlords.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on April 1,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
